DPFs and DOCs are quoted at $10 to $700 per part depending on the part number and PGM loading. The same unit sold blind to a scrap metal buyer brings $0.50 to $3.00. The diesel oxidation catalyst, despite being the smallest part of the system, usually holds the highest value of the lot.
Why DPFs have no sticker price
There is no per-pound diesel particulate filter scrap value and there never will be, because two filters of identical size can differ by fifty times in what they contain.
Recyclers describe it plainly: the amount of PGM in each part determines the value, and there is a vast range in PGM content between one DPF or DOC and another. A reputable buyer should be able to quote by part number rather than by look or weight.
So the first thing to do with any diesel emissions part is photograph the label, exactly as with a catalytic converter.
DOC, DPF and SCR: which is which
A diesel exhaust system is not one part, and the value order is the opposite of what size suggests.
The diesel oxidation catalyst sits at the head of the system and converts carbon monoxide to carbon dioxide while breaking down residual fuel. The doc filter scrap price surprises people: it is described as the most compact part of a diesel converter and yet the one that holds the greatest recycling value, because of its concentration of platinum and palladium.
The diesel particulate filter is engineered to trap soot. Its job is filtration rather than catalysis, so PGM content varies enormously: some DPF systems contain valuable metals, others carry limited precious metal content.
SCR catalysts appear on systems using selective catalytic reduction for nitrogen oxides. Many diesel systems instead use exhaust gas recirculation and carry no SCR at all, so the scr catalyst scrap value question only arises on some vehicles.
The diesel cat vs dpf distinction therefore matters at the counter: sell them as separate parts with separate numbers, not as one lump of exhaust.

The two extremes in that table describe the same object. A part quoted between $10 and $700 by a specialist becomes $0.50 to $3.00 at a general scrap yard that grades it as steel.
That is not the yard being unfair. They have no assay capability and no part-number database, so they are buying a stainless canister with something ceramic inside it.
High-grade and low-grade filters
Recyclers split DPFs into two categories, and knowing which you have sets expectations before you call.
High-grade DPFs carry a higher concentration of platinum group metals. These are typically the heavy-duty on-road units fitted since emissions rules tightened, and they sit at the upper end of the range.
Lower-grade units carry limited precious metal because the filter is doing filtration work rather than catalytic work, with the catalysis handled upstream by the DOC.
One further split applies across all autocatalysts and is worth knowing: OEM units carry significantly higher PGM loadings than aftermarket ones, because aftermarket parts are built to meet minimum emissions requirements at lower production cost. Confusing the two leads to inaccurate payments in both directions.
The assay process behind every dpf recycling price
This is where DPF pricing differs from almost everything else on this site.
A specialist does not estimate. The unit is de-canned, the substrate is crushed and homogenised, and a sample is analysed to determine actual platinum, palladium and rhodium content. Settlement follows the assay against prevailing metal prices.
That is why a dpf assay report explained properly should show the sample weight, the assayed grams per tonne of each metal, the metal prices used and the settlement date. If a buyer cannot produce those, they are estimating rather than assaying.
The practical consequence: assay-based settlement suits volume. A fleet with a pallet of filters gets a genuine analysis. A single filter is usually priced from a part-number table instead, which is faster and perfectly reasonable.
Ash load, and what it actually does
Here is the part most sellers misunderstand.
Ash is not soot. Soot burns off during regeneration; ash does not. It accumulates permanently, and its main sources are engine lubricating oil additives, plus fuel, engine wear and corrosion.
Ash accumulation is described as one of the most important factors limiting a filter's service life. It raises pressure drop, hurts fuel economy, and reduces the effective channel diameter and filter length.
There is a curious consequence worth knowing: after extended service, the ash layer itself becomes the filter medium, physically separating the soot from the channel walls, with the substrate acting merely as a support.
For value, the effect is indirect rather than direct. Ash does not remove PGM from the washcoat, so a heavily ashed filter is not stripped of its metal. What ash does is end the filter's working life, which is why it arrived at you in the first place, and it adds weight and volume that the recycler must process before assaying.
The ash disposal problem
A regulatory point that catches fleets out, and it belongs to whoever cleans the filter rather than whoever sells it.
The EPA issued a technical bulletin on diesel particulate ash disposal in 2009. DPF ash may contain trace PGM dislodged from the substrate during cleaning, which is the same material recyclers reclaim.
In California it has become industry standard to treat DPF ash as hazardous waste and manage it accordingly. A generator has two options: assume the ash is hazardous based on knowledge that other tests have found it so, or have it tested by a state-authorised facility. Test data showing the residue falls below the thresholds allows the material to be shipped freely.
So for a workshop cleaning filters regularly, ash is a cost line rather than a revenue one, and the cost varies by state.
Heavy truck filters: the big-ticket end
The semi truck dpf scrap end of the market is where the numbers get serious, and the semi truck page covers it alongside the rest of the vehicle.
Since 2007, new heavy-duty on-road diesel trucks sold in North America have carried both a DPF and a DOC. Those units are larger and more heavily loaded than passenger car equivalents, which puts them at the top of the published range.
For fleets, that adds up. A yard of decommissioned trucks represents a genuine asset rather than a disposal problem, and dpf buyers for fleets typically quote against a part-number list and arrange collection.
